Question

Which three types of Al workloads could be combined to facilitate a human engaging with an Al agent to submit a suitable profile photo?

Select all that apply.

A. Conversational Al
B. Natural Language Processing
C. Computer Vision
D. Anomaly detection

Answer

A. Conversational Al
B. Natural Language Processing
C. Computer Vision

Explanation

In this case you could use a combination of Computer Vision, Conversational AI, and Natural Language Processing workloads.

The correct answer is A, B, and C. AI workloads are the tasks or processes that AI systems can perform to achieve a specific goal or outcome. AI workloads can be combined to create more complex and interactive applications that can handle multiple types of data and scenarios. In this case, the three types of AI workloads that could be combined to facilitate a human engaging with an AI agent to submit a suitable profile photo are:

  • A. Conversational AI: This is an AI workload that enables natural and intuitive communication between humans and machines using voice or text. Conversational AI can use techniques, such as natural language processing, natural language understanding, natural language generation, speech recognition, and speech synthesis, to understand the user’s intent, context, and emotions, and to generate appropriate and personalized responses. Conversational AI can also use techniques, such as dialogue management, sentiment analysis, and personality detection, to maintain a coherent and engaging conversation, and to adapt to the user’s preferences and feedback. For example, conversational AI can be used to create chatbots, voice assistants, and virtual agents that can interact with users through various channels and platforms, such as websites, mobile apps, social media, and smart devices.
  • B. Natural Language Processing: This is an AI workload that involves processing, analyzing, and generating natural language, such as written or spoken text. Natural language processing can use techniques, such as tokenization, lemmatization, stemming, part-of-speech tagging, named entity recognition, dependency parsing, and semantic analysis, to extract and structure the information and meaning from natural language. Natural language processing can also use techniques, such as machine translation, text summarization, text classification, question answering, and text generation, to perform various tasks and applications using natural language. For example, natural language processing can be used to create search engines, spell checkers, grammar checkers, plagiarism detectors, and content generators.
  • C. Computer Vision: This is an AI workload that involves processing, analyzing, and understanding visual data, such as images or videos. Computer vision can use techniques, such as image processing, feature extraction, object detection, face recognition, facial expression analysis, optical character recognition, scene understanding, and image generation, to perform various tasks and applications using visual data. For example, computer vision can be used to create face filters, face unlock, biometric authentication, document scanning, augmented reality, and virtual reality.

These three types of AI workloads could be combined to facilitate a human engaging with an AI agent to submit a suitable profile photo by enabling the following scenario:

  • The user initiates a conversation with the AI agent through a voice or text interface, such as a website, a mobile app, or a smart device.
  • The AI agent uses conversational AI to greet the user, introduce itself, and explain the purpose and process of submitting a profile photo.
  • The AI agent uses natural language processing to understand the user’s queries, requests, and feedback, and to generate relevant and helpful responses.
  • The AI agent uses computer vision to analyze the user’s uploaded or captured profile photo, and to provide feedback and suggestions on how to improve it, such as adjusting the lighting, angle, background, or expression.
  • The AI agent uses conversational AI to guide the user through the steps of submitting a suitable profile photo, and to confirm the user’s satisfaction and completion of the task.
